About Yunyang Zhao

Yunyang Zhao is a scholar working on Materials Chemistry, Health, Toxicology and Mutagenesis and Biomedical Engineering, having authored 15 papers that have together received 473 indexed citations. Recurring topics across this work include Carbon and Quantum Dots Applications (13 papers), Nanocluster Synthesis and Applications (6 papers) and Luminescence and Fluorescent Materials (4 papers). The work is most often cited by research in Materials Chemistry (395 citations), Spectroscopy (40 citations) and Renewable Energy, Sustainability and the Environment (34 citations). Yunyang Zhao has collaborated with scholars based in China and Macao. Frequent co-authors include Songlin Zuo, Zikang Tang, Songnan Qu, Meng Miao, Shuangpeng Wang, Shuai Meng, Qijun Li, Jing Tan, Yuchen Li and Mai Luo.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Hazardous Materials and Carbon.
